Concept Art is an art form used extensively in the entertainment industry to visualize ideas for films, video games, animations, and more before they are brought to life. It serves as a visual representation of characters, settings, and objects, providing a tangible form to abstract concepts and guiding the development process. Concept Art ranges from rough sketches to highly detailed illustrations, focusing on creativity, atmosphere, and mood rather than on precise technical detail. It often involves a combination of traditional and digital techniques, allowing for rapid iteration and adjustment according to the creative direction of a project.
